Thomas Massie: Thomas Massie is facing a Donald Trump-backed challenger in Kentucky, indicating Donald Trump's continued efforts to target Republican critics following Bill Cassidy's defeat.
Donald Trump: Donald Trump's endorsement was a key factor in the defeat of Bill Cassidy and the advancement of Julia Letlow and John Fleming. This event further demonstrates Donald Trump's significant influence over the Republican Party.

Thomas Massie: Thomas Massie is another Republican US Representative whom Donald Trump hopes to unseat in an upcoming primary, indicating a broader pattern of Trump's retribution campaign.
Donald Trump: Donald Trump successfully influenced the primary election, demonstrating his ability to unseat Republican opponents, which is a political victory for his retribution campaign.

Thomas Massie: Thomas Massie, a Republican Representative, is demanding a public vote in the United States on a bipartisan measure to stop the military action against Iran, criticizing Donald Trump's 'America First' slogan.

Thomas Massie: Thomas Massie, a Republican Representative, sponsored legislation to force the disclosure of Epstein files and accused the United States — United States Department of Justice of breaking the law by missing deadlines and excessive redactions.
